Output 8c738596343e0e985f16a809507625cd0833d1d4dfe0138671f394e13ea62cba:1

value
95232729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ef35e8c858f1917613fb6be4528a182eb94538 OP_EQUAL
address
39AFDizDFJaJebkwziuMogFAvcCj7fZAoo
transaction
8c738596343e0e985f16a809507625cd0833d1d4dfe0138671f394e13ea62cba